Yosef Wosk

Yosef Wosk, Ph.D., OBC, is a Canadian author, scholar, and philanthropist. He has served as a professor and director of interdisciplinary programs at Simon Fraser University and has published extensively in the fields of religion, literature, and philosophy. Wosk's contributions to community and intellectual life have been recognized through numerous awards, including the Order of British Columbia and the Queen Elizabeth II Diamond Jubilee Medal. His interests are broad, spanning from the preservation of cultural heritage to the promotion of dialogue between different cultural and philosophical disciplines. Yosef Wosk's work often explores the intersections of technology, spirituality, and humanism, reflecting his deep commitment to lifelong learning and education. Beyond academia, he has been actively involved in community service, contributing to various cultural, educational, and religious organizations.
